This method of data capture will always report from the exact second, even if
the time parameter is entered with fractional seconds. For example, entering
MET PM 14:14:12.200 will result in the same data capture as MET PM
14:14:12, because the relay ignores the fractional seconds.
See MET PM on page R.9.31 for complete command options, and error
messages.

C37.118 Synchrophasor Protocol
The SEL-421 complies with IEEE C37.118, Standard for Synchrophasors for
Power Systems, when Global setting MFRMT := C37.118.
The protocol is available on serial ports 1, 2, 3, and F by setting the
corresponding Port setting PROTO := PMU.
The protocol is available on the Ethernet port when EPMIP := Y.
This subsection does not cover the details of the protocol, but highlights some
of the important features and options that are available.
